    The Glitch Mob are putting out a new album called "Love Death Immortality"! The album follows the group's 2010 debut album, "Drink The Sea", and will be out on February 11, 2014, via Glass Air Records.

    "Love Death Immortality" tracklist:

    1. "Mind Of A Beast"
    2. "Our Demons" (featuring Aja Volkman)
    3. "Skullclub"
    4. "Becoming Harmonious" (featuring Metal Mother)
    5. "Can't Kill Us"
    6. "I Need My Memory Back" (featuring Aja Volkman)
    7. "Skytoucher"
    8. "Fly By Night Only" (featuring Yaarrohs)
    9. "Carry The Sun"
    10. "Beauty Of The Unhidden Heart" (featuring Sister Crayon)
    In some parts of the world, the album is available for pre-order on iTunes right now. Previews of the album artwork have been posted up on Tumblr in the lead-up to the announcement.
